In the heart of the exhilarating and often tumultuous world of journalism, Never in My Wildest Dreams: A Black Woman's Life in Journalism stands out as a vibrant, courageous testament to defiance and resilience. This memoir is not just a recollection of experiences; it's a clarion call for acknowledgment in a field historically dominated by white narratives, relentlessly carving out a space for Black voices. With the authorship of Belva Davis- a pioneering journalist and trailblazer- this gripping narrative weaves the personal with the political, laying bare the raw realities of her journey traversing a male-dominated profession in the 20th century.

From bustling newsrooms to the touchstone events that defined an era, Davis imparts her experiences with an honesty that is both refreshing and haunting. Each page turns like the gears of an old, worn typewriter, resonating with the cadence of a life steeped in tenacity. Her story is an ecological mix of triumph and tragedy, triumphantly breaking barriers while also confronting the insidious weeds of racism and sexism that threatened to choke her ambitions.

Readers are plunged into a whirlwind of emotions as Davis recounts her early days growing up in a segregated America, where her dreams seemed unrealizable. Yet, against all odds, she persisted, fueled by a vision that extended far beyond her circumstances. Her voice-rich, unapologetic, and imbued with passion-echoes the struggles and dreams of many Black women who find themselves unseen, unheard.
